Abstract:
An analysis into the phase matching condition of four-wave-mixing in highly birefringence photonic crystal fiber is presented to yield independent processes combining the nonlinear terms with those of linear terms. The pump wavelength, power and pump pulse incident angles effects on the anti-Stokes frequency shifts are analyzed. The results show that the high order dispersion can ignored result with the anomalous dispersion region in contrast conclusion, which is in good agreement with the experiment results. Furthermore, there exists to guide the polarization, power-independent anti-Stokes emissions.
